Tips for Finding Human Resources Jobs at Twilio Jobs

Align your HR credentials to tech-sector norms

Twilio evaluates HR candidates against technology industry benchmarks, not traditional enterprise HR profiles. Certifications like SHRM-CP or PHR carry weight, but experience supporting software engineering or product teams signals direct relevance to the role.

Confirm specialty occupation standing before applying

H-1B eligibility for HR roles hinges on whether the position requires a bachelor's degree in a specific field. Roles like HR Business Partner or Compensation Analyst typically qualify; generalist coordinator titles can be harder to support. Review the job description carefully before assuming sponsorship applies.

Target HR business partner openings over coordinator roles

Twilio's sponsored HR hires skew toward strategic and analytical functions. Business partner, total rewards, and people analytics roles have clearer specialty occupation eligibility than administrative or coordinator titles, which can face more USCIS scrutiny during the H-1B petition review.

Engage Twilio's recruiting team about LCA timing early

Before accepting an offer, confirm the Labor Condition Application filing timeline with your recruiter. The LCA must be certified by the DOL before USCIS can receive your H-1B petition, and delays in that step affect your start date, particularly for H-1B transfers or cap-exempt filings.

Prepare your OPT STEM extension case proactively

If you're on F-1 OPT and targeting Twilio HR roles, verify that your degree field qualifies for the 24-month STEM extension. Twilio participates in E-Verify, which is required for STEM OPT employers, so confirm your offer letter and I-983 training plan are ready before your initial OPT expires.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does Twilio sponsor H-1B visas for Human Resources roles?

Yes, Twilio sponsors H-1B visas for Human Resources positions where the role qualifies as a specialty occupation under USCIS standards. Strategic and analytical HR roles, such as HR Business Partner, Compensation Analyst, or People Analytics Manager, are the most straightforward fits. Generalist or coordinator-level titles can be harder to support and may require additional documentation to establish specialty occupation eligibility.

Which visa types does Twilio commonly sponsor for Human Resources positions?

Twilio sponsors H-1B and TN visas for nonimmigrant work authorization in HR roles. For longer-term pathways, the company supports EB-2 and EB-3 Green Card sponsorship through PERM labor certification. F-1 OPT and CPT are also accommodated, and Twilio's participation in E-Verify satisfies the employer requirement for STEM OPT extensions.

What qualifications does Twilio expect for sponsored Human Resources roles?

Twilio typically looks for HR professionals with a b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Organizational Psychology, Business Administration, or a related field. For sponsored roles, the degree-to-job match matters for H-1B specialty occupation purposes. Practical experience supporting fast-paced, data-driven tech environments, familiarity with HR information systems like Workday, and any people analytics exposure strengthen your profile significantly.

How do I time my application around the H-1B cap and petition process?

If you need a new H-1B cap slot, USCIS opens registration each March for an October 1 start date. Securing an offer from Twilio well before the March registration window gives your employer time to prepare the petition. If you're transferring an existing H-1B, there's no cap constraint and Twilio can file year-round, often allowing you to start before USCIS issues a final approval under portability rules.
